Dr. Tabitha Wood Trainees will take pleasure in more than 2 dozen indoor and outside interactive workshops, consisting of a chemistry magic show, fish filleting, robotics, 'just a byte' coding, solidified carbon dioxide physics experiments, engineering obstacles, and stop-motion animation, plus 3D design and printing and tree-ring dating.

" We also have a new Native food science session focusing on wild rice where kids will get to try popped wild rice, which is such a fun method to bring back standard foods," Nelson stated. Numerous of the workshop sessions incorporate Native knowledges, languages, and practices. Volunteer ambassadors explore each classroom group around school.

New faculty members are participating this year, including Prof. Karen Froman, Assistant Teacher in the Department of History, who will leading a workshop on the science and innovation behind leather and fur production. Many UWinnipeg Collegiate, undergraduate, and graduate students likewise volunteer at STEM Days, making it a really intergenerational occasion.

Dr. Tabitha Wood, Performing Dean of Science and Partner Teacher in UWinnipeg's Department of Chemistry, who has actually offered with Science Rendezvous for over 10 years, stated public outreach occasions are an important method to kindle excitement for STEM knowing in people of any ages and backgrounds.

Wood stated. "We want to be that trigger for the children showing up for STEM Days." Developed in 2022, STEM Days began as a one-day occasion developed to spark the creativities of the next generation of STEM (science, innovation, engineering, and mathematics) leaders, and motivate their curiosity, culture, and self-confidence through hands-on knowing.

By 2023, that number had grown to over 550 trainees. In 2024 and 2025, STEM Days broadened to two days to accommodate over 1,000 trainees from nine Winnipeg schools and 2 First Country schools. STEM Days prioritizes inner-city, North End, and First Nation schools as part of UWinnipeg's dedication to create pathways for underrepresented youth and supply local neighborhoods with access to school.
